For the second Saturday running Newark failed to get any reward for a spirited display as they went down to an abrasive Dronfield outfit. With Easter approaching, only Will Fry remained of the Lincoln University contingent, the gaps filled by Ryan Ashley, Alex Boswell and Reece Self, with Tyler Martin and Lewis Cawthorne also starting.
There was nothing to choose between the sides in the early stages, Boswell being inches away from converting a left wing cross before being called into action at the other end doing well to rob Gordon as he lined up his shot. Newark came close to opening the scoring on 17 minutes as keeper Conroy palmed an in-swinging Fry corner against the bar, the ball falling kindly for the defence to clear. Town were denied a penalty as Martin was pushed in the back as he pursued a long ball from Ashley, but the claim was waved away. Cawthorne pushed a fierce effort from Savage over the bar before Rhys Stanley was thwarted by a good block by the keeper as he ran clear of the defence. As half time approached Stanley was again denied by Conroy, and just as it seemed the first half would be goalless, the Blues received a setback as Dronfield took a 44th minute lead. A Savage free kick was headed across the goal by Jones for Batterham to force a short range header home, the goal allowed despite claims that Cawthorne had been impeded.
Things got worse within two minutes of the restart, Cawthorne fumbling a high basll into the area to allow Bradwell an easy second goal. The arrears should have been reduced a minute later, as another long ball was fired into the side netting by Stanley with Martin better placed to finish. Newark were awarded a penalty on 55 minutes for a push in the area, but the decision was reversed after the intervention of a late offside flag. Newark did pull a goal back with 61 minutes gone, Joe Parker blasting the ball past the powerless Conroy. A flurry of substitutions followed, one of the Newark replacements, Aaran Needham going closest to an equaliser, Conroy beating the ball clear. Needham then played Martin in but the keeper was again equal to the task. As time ran out, Cawthorne atoned for his earlier error with excellent saves from Bradwell and Earl, but yet again Newark were left to rue missed opportunities.
